الملخص EN

The aim of this study was to assay the effects of Coreopsis tinctoria Nutt.

flower extracts on hyperglycemia of diet-induced obese mice and the underlying mechanisms.

Coreopsis tinctoria flower was extracted with ethanol and water, respectively.

The total phenol, flavonoid levels, and the constituents of the extracts were measured.

For the animal experiments, C57BL/6 mice were fed with a chow diet, high-fat diet, or high-fat diet mixed with 0.4% (w/w) water and ethanol extracts of Coreopsis tinctoria flower for 8 weeks.

The inhibitory effects of the extracts on α-glucosidase activity and the antioxidant properties were assayed in vitro.

We found that the extracts blocked the increase of fasting blood glucose, serum triglyceride (TG), insulin, leptin, and liver lipid levels and prevented the development of glucose tolerance impairment and insulin resistance in the C57BL/6 mice induced by a high-fat diet.

The extracts inhibited α-glycosidase activity and increased oxidant activity in vitro.

In conclusion, Coreopsis tinctoria flower extracts may ameliorate high-fat diet-induced hyperglycemia and insulin resistance.

The underling mechanism may be via the inhibition of α-glucosidase activity.

Our data indicate that Coreopsis tinctoria flower could be used as a beverage supplement and a potential source of drugs for treatment of diabetics.
